Transaction 63363d8ab9bdb84b1e2fa54f9b367ecc36c5dd98d79a96020e98d13d494ed373
1 Input
1 Output
-
63363d8ab9bdb84b1e2fa54f9b367ecc36c5dd98d79a96020e98d13d494ed373:0
- value
- 443962
- script pubkey
- OP_0 OP_PUSHBYTES_20 4784ab8509745de0d385366811a4817b9e426313
- address
- bc1qg7z2hpgfw3w7p5u9xe5prfyp0w0yyccnfn3znj